Do you have a refugium connected to the system and are you able to "disconnect" any adjoining systems?

If you can seperate the the dragonet, it would make your life much easier. The LFS is correct, it will pose a future problem if not dealt with like the rest. As for the eel, same thing. Even though they are highly resistant, they are like the dragonet, not immune. Best treatment to use in regards to the eel is hyposalinity.

Actually I would suggest placing the mandarin in the refugium and disconnecting each system from the main. This will allow you to fallow the main tank and at the same time attempt to wien the mandarine onto prepared foods with some dilligence and patience.
http://marineaquariumadvice.com/synchiropus_splendidus_series_1.html

Remove as much rock from the eel tank if there is any. Just place it in a pail with heater/powerhead for the next two months. You will then be able to treat it by itself if you like. Just watch the water quality as there will be some die off from the sand.

http://www.petsforum.com/personal/trevor-jones/hyposalinity.html

Very important with hypo is to watch the pH and salinity several time daily. Especially the pH in thefirst week and while dropping the salinity initially. Use buffered RO to aid the diluted chemistry and keep the pH steady while dropping the salinity. Be sure to use a refractometer.

It wasn't my intention that you should use hypo in the refugium. The "purpose" of moving the mardarin there was two fold. You eliminate all fish from the main so it can fallow appropriately and also to provide the mandarin with the right care environment (small, no tank mates, low flow) while you train it to accept prepared foods. If accomplished, you will have a much better go of treating it and ensuring your main display remains parasite free. After it's training period in the fuge, it can be moved to the QT after the others are done for it's neccessary treatment and then fallow the fuge as needed.

A little extra effort for sure but given your circumstances, not much options. 8)
